Analysis of factors affecting accuracy of numerical manifold method
The cover functions of Numerical Manifold Method have two types,such as completed overlapping cover and partial overlapping cover.Governing equations of one-dimensional high-order numerical manifold method with both two covers have been deduced by the general method of weighted residuals.By using the proposed method,a series of numerical experiments have been completed to discuss the factors affecting accuracy,such as the linear dependence problem,the influence of size,order and overlapping ratio of covers.A highly oscillatory differential equation has also been solved.In addition,a posteriori error method is adopted for evaluating the accuracy of the algorithm.The results indicate that the appliance of independent regions can decline even eliminate the linear dependence property of stiffness matrix.The condition number of stiffness matrix is obviously better when using the independent regions.The accuracy of solution increases with the decreasing of overlapping ratio and the increasing of order of cover function.This paper attempts to enrich the theory and practical field of the NMM.
